What can I expect from the weather in Jojutla?
Weather is only one factor, but it can really affect your travel plans, especially if you are planning a longer stay in Jojutla. The hottest months are usually April and March, with an average temperature of 22°C, while the coldest months are January and December, with an average of 18°C. The rainiest months in Jojutla are September, June, August and July, with each month seeing an average of 232 mm of rainfall.
What should I see and do in Jojutla?
Family-friendly attractions include Jardines de México and Aquasplash Water Park, whereas Tequesquitengo Lake and Sierra de Huautla Biosphere Reserve are a couple of great spots to enjoy the outdoors. In the wider area, you'll find Glorieta de las Alas and San Pedro Church.
